It's All About Auburn

I have to admit that I do not want to see Alabama win the game Thursday night, SEC be damned when it comes to Bama. On the other hand, it's not the end of the world if they do win because it's all about the future of Auburn Football.

THIS YEAR the present coaching staff has proven that we can get the players that can take us places we've never seen and there's nothing the Bama Nation can do to stop our progress. The Bear may have assimilated the SEC in a resistance is futile sort of way, in 1958, but those days are long gone.

It's taken Auburn 50 plus years to get to where we seem to be now. I'm not talking about 8-5, I'm talking about the new businesslike approach, the tireless work ethic and the desire on behalf of the university, Jay Jacobs and the coaching staff to fulfill Auburn's football potential.

The storm has been building since coach Dye stepped foot on the campus and gave us a strong dose of winning, Bowden followed Dye us with an incredible 20 wins in his first two years and lastly Tubs got us two steps from the mountain top. It feels like the desires of the school and the fans are finally on the same page. And it feels good.

It's not about Alabama's 7 or even 8 national championships it's about Auburn's 2nd and 3rd and 4th and 5th national championships. War Eagle and Hook em Horns!!!!
